Warren Hannum graduated from the U.S. Military Academy at West Point, Class of 1902. He retire d as a U.S. Army Brigadier General.
(Citation Needed) – SYNOPSIS: Brigadier General (Retired) Warren Thomas Hannum, United States Army, was awarded the Legion of Merit for exceptionally meritorious conduct in the performance of outstanding services to the Government of the United States during World War II.

The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ress, July 9, 1918, takes pleasure in presenting the Army Distinguished Service Medal to Colonel (Corps of Engineers) Warren Thomas Hannum, United States Army, for exceptionally meritorious and distinguished services to the Government of the United States, in a duty of great responsibility during World War I. As a member of the Training Section, General Staff, Colonel Hannum efficiently supervised the technical and tactical training of engineer, gas, and tank troops and the operation of the schools for those services. In the performance of his manifold duties he displayed military attainments of a high order, rendering service of importance to the American Expeditionary Forces.
